Tesla START, complete with a simulated service station for electric vehicles, is the first community college training program associated with the Palo Alto-based company. This first class of Tesla START students at CPCC will graduate April 6. "We are proud and excited at Central Piedmont that Tesla reached out us with the opportunity to be among their first community college partners," says Jeff Lowrance, Public Information Officer and Special Assistant to the President at CPCC. We partner with colleges across the country to integrate Tesla START into automotive, collision and manufacturing curriculums as a multi-week capstoneproviding individuals with a smooth transition from college to full-time employment at Tesla or elsewhere. Students train in a space on campus designed to simulate a Tesla Service location so they are ready to hit the ground running on day one of their new careers. Tesla founder Elon Musk himself is not attending the graduation ceremony. The START program is a 12-week course that adds onto the automotive technology programs at the partnering schools. The all-electric car maker has collaborated with a few colleges across the United States to teach the Tesla START curriculum. Tesla START is a 12-week technician training program designed to provide students with the skills needed to be service technicians at Tesla Service Centers across North America. became the first community college in the country to host the Tesla START program, a partnership that provides students with the skills necessary for job placement as service technicians at Tesla service centers . Tesla START is currently available through two community colleges Central Piedmont Community College (CPCC) in Charlotte, North Carolina, and Rio Hondo College in Whittier, California and will likely be expanding soon. Since this goes on top of your general automotive training, you will only focus on Tesla/Electric Vehicle mechanics. Students chosen for the program earn a wage from Tesla while attending classes (the company wouldn't comment on how much), and those who earn grades of 80 percent or higher are guaranteed a job at a Tesla service center after graduation.
